15 Kids Garden Crafts

June 9, 2015

After such long winters in Northern Michigan, one of my favorite things to do in spring is to get outside in my garden.  My mom and dad instilled a love of gardening in me as a child.  I’ll be honest I hated those days of planting and weeding but eventually somewhere along the way I learned to love gardening.  I even find weeding garden beds relaxing and a great stress reliever.  I’ve had gardening on my mind and I will have my grandkids coming home the first week of July and thought it might be fun to do a project or two with them. I’ve rounded up 15 Kids Garden Crafts.  Now I just need to decide which one I’d like to do.  I’ve included some easier ones for small children and some harder ones for those older kids.
